Powerful and Industrial Arc Shaped NdFeB Magnets: The Driving Force for Modern Industries
In the rapidly advancing world of technology and industry, the demand for powerful magnets continues to grow. One type of magnet that has gained popularity due to its incredible strength and versatility is the arc shaped NdFeB magnet.
NdFeB, or neodymium iron boron, magnets are recognized as one of the strongest permanent magnets commercially available. With their high magnetic properties, these magnets have become essential components in a wide range of industries. The arc shape of these magnets offers additional advantages, making them even more valuable for various applications.
The unique design of arc shaped NdFeB magnets allows for increased holding power and improved performance. Their curved structure creates a concentrated magnetic field towards one direction, making them ideal for applications where it is crucial to direct the magnetic force in a specific area. Additionally, this design provides a larger magnetic surface area, making these magnets more efficient in attracting and holding objects.
One of the key industrial sectors that heavily rely on the power of arc shaped NdFeB magnets is the manufacturing industry. These magnets find use in motor systems, particularly in electric vehicles and wind turbines. Due to their strong magnetic force, arc shaped NdFeB magnets are crucial in generating and converting electrical energy into mechanical energy, providing tremendous power and efficiency to these systems.
The automotive industry also benefits greatly from these powerful magnets. In electric vehicles, arc shaped NdFeB magnets are vital components of the electric motor, enabling high-performance acceleration and efficient energy conversion. These magnets contribute to the overall compactness and lightweight design of electric vehicles while maintaining exceptional power output.
Moreover, arc shaped NdFeB magnets are widely used in the medical industry. With their strong magnetic force, these magnets are essential in magnetic resonance imaging (MRI) machines, enabling accurate and detailed imaging of internal body parts. Their ability to generate strong magnetic fields plays a significant role in the diagnosis and treatment of various medical conditions.
The aerospace industry is another field that significantly benefits from arc shaped NdFeB magnets. These magnets are utilized in navigation systems, electric actuators, and control devices due to their high magnetic properties. Their reliability and ability to withstand extreme conditions make them ideal for the demanding aerospace applications.
